八年级学生数学素养的测评研究

  本文选题:数学素养 + PISA ; 参考:《华中师范大学》2017年硕士论文


【摘要】:数学作为推动科学技术进步的关键力量,而数学素养则是科技高速发展的现代人们适应生活的必要条件。中学阶段是学生智力发展的关键阶段,也是培养学生数学素养的最佳时期,对学生的数学素养现状的调查有助于了解学生数学素养状况,分析影响学生数学素养的关键因素,改进中学教师的教学理念和教学方法,从而促进学生数学素养水平的提高。本文从国内外数学素养的研究中系统分析了数学素养的内涵、特征以及构成要素。在此基础上,深入分析国际PISA测评的特点和测评题的开发设计方法,参考我国《初中数学课程标准2011年》,以北京师大版的初中数学教材为基础编制了数学素养的测评题来研究初中生的数学素养现状。测评题是以深圳市龙岗区的三所中学的八年级学生为研究对象,数据采用SPSS22.0统计软件进行分析,得出了以下结论:(1)初中生的数学素养处于中等水平。其中情境维度:学生在熟悉的问题情境中表现较好;内容维度:学生在不确定性和数据中得分最高;过程维度:学生在数学表述得分最高;能力维度:学生在沟通能力中表现最好;题型维度:学生在选择题中得分最高。(2)学生存在的不足。学生解决社会情境问题能力欠佳,几何素养水平相对于其他的内容领域处于薄弱地位,学生的数学反思能力不足,创造性表现不够突出。(3)不同学校的学生数学素养水平存在显著差异。总体而言,较好学校的学生的数学素养状况优于较差学校的学生的数学素养状况,但在一些单项分析上出现反超现象,这个现象有待于进一步分析成因。基于以上研究结果提出,数学教学要从学生的数学素养现状和影响因素出发,因此对教师的教学有针对性地给出以下建议:(1)创设基于现实生活的多样化的问题情境。(2)加强培养学生的几何素养。(3)创建有利于发展学生反思能力的教学设计和评价。(4)关注学生数学阅读能力的持续发展。(5)尊重学生思维差异,促进学生创造力的发展。本文的创新之处在于:(1)借鉴于国际知名的PISA测试题设计理念,结合我国社会的现实情境,编制了一套适用于本土的测评试题(2)测评题经历“专家讨论-命制样卷-样卷检测分析-部分地区试测-样卷更改-正式测试”这样一条规范的开发路线,编制的测评试题的信度和效度均检测良好。(3)对测评数据分析从多个方面展开,保证分析结果的科学性和严谨性。
[Abstract]:Mathematics is the key force to push forward the progress of science and technology, and mathematics literacy is the necessary condition for modern people to adapt to life with the rapid development of science and technology. The middle school stage is the key stage of the students' intelligence development and the best time to cultivate the students' mathematics literacy. The investigation of the present situation of the students' mathematics literacy is helpful to understand the students' mathematics literacy status and analyze the key factors that affect the students' mathematics literacy. Improve the teaching idea and teaching method of middle school teachers, thus promote the improvement of students' mathematics literacy level. This paper systematically analyzes the connotation, characteristics and elements of mathematics literacy from the research of mathematics literacy at home and abroad. On this basis, the characteristics of international PISA evaluation and the development and design methods of the evaluation questions are analyzed. Referring to the Chinese Junior Middle School Mathematics Curriculum Standard 2011, based on the junior high school mathematics teaching materials of Beijing normal University, this paper compiled the mathematics literacy evaluation questions to study the present situation of junior high school students' mathematics literacy. Taking the eighth grade students of three middle schools in Longgang District of Shenzhen as the research object, the data are analyzed by SPSS22.0 software, and the following conclusions are drawn: the junior middle school students' mathematics literacy is at the middle level. Among them, situational dimension: students perform well in familiar problem situations; content dimension: students score the highest in uncertainty and data; process dimension: students get the highest score in mathematical expression; Ability dimension: students' communication ability is the best; problem type dimension: students' highest scores in multiple choice questions. Students' ability to solve social situational problems is poor, the level of geometric literacy is in a weak position compared with other content areas, and the students' ability to reflect on mathematics is insufficient. Creative performance is not outstanding. 3) there are significant differences in students' mathematical literacy level in different schools. In general, the mathematical literacy of the students in the better schools is better than that of the students in the worse schools, but there is a phenomenon of counter-superfluous in some individual analysis, which needs to be further analyzed. Based on the above research results, it is suggested that mathematics teaching should proceed from the present situation of students' mathematical literacy and the influencing factors. Therefore, this paper gives the following suggestions to teachers' teaching: 1) creating diversified problem situations based on real life. 2) strengthening the cultivation of students' geometric literacy. 3) creating teaching design and evaluation conducive to the development of students' reflective ability. Pay attention to the sustainable development of students' mathematical reading ability. (5) respect the difference of students' thinking. Promote the development of students' creativity. The innovation of this paper lies in: (1) drawing lessons from the internationally famous design concept of PISA test questions, combining with the realistic situation of our society, We have compiled a set of test questions that are suitable for local use. They have experienced a standard development route, such as "expert discussion-ordering sample volume-sample volume detection and analysis-part of regional test-sample volume modification-formal test" as a standard development route, "expert discussion-ordering sample volume-sample volume detection and analysis-part of the area test-sample volume change-formal test" The reliability and validity of the test questions are tested well. 3) the analysis of the test data is carried out from many aspects to ensure the scientific and rigorous results of the analysis.
